What's geometric about a "geometric progression"?

An arithmetic progression is $a+0b, a+1b, a+2b, ..., a+nb$

A geometric progression is $ab^0, ab^1, ab^2, ..., ab^n$.

Multiplication is arithmetic, so why is a geometric progression not also an "arithmetic" progression?

A line being extended be iteratively adding a constant length is a geometric construction, so why is an arithmetic progression not also a "geometric" progression?
